Abstract
This paper investigates the stability and stabilization analysis problem of nonlinear systems with distributed time-delay. The T-S fuzzy model is employed to describe the nonlinear plant. When designing fuzzy controller, the novel imperfect premise matching method is adopted, which allows the fuzzy model and the fuzzy controller to use different premise membership functions and different number of rules. As a result, greater design flexibility can be obtained. By applying a new tighter integral inequality which involves information about the double integral of the system states, and introducing the information of membership functions, less conservative stability and stabilization conditions are derived. Finally, a numerical example is provided to clarify the effectiveness of the proposed approach.
Access provided by CONRICYT-eBooks. Download conference paper PDF
Similar content being viewed by others
Keywords
1 Introduction
Time-delay is a common phenomenon in practical control systems, which can deteriorate the system performance and cause instability. Therefore, the research for control systems with time-delay is crucial and has received considerable attention [1, 2]. When analyzing the stability conditions of control systems with time-delay, a Lyapunov-Krasovskii functional (LKF) approach [3] is usually applied, which can denote the conditions in terms of linear matrix inequalities (LMIs). Though the LKF approach can handle the stability analysis problem for time-delay systems, the criteria derived from LKF method are conservative. To reduce conservatism, much research has been done: the free-weighting matrix [4] technique was introduced to obtain more tighter bound of the derivative of Lyapunov function; the wirtinger-based integral inequality [5] was developed to deal with integral term \(\int _{t-h}^{t}\dot{\mathbf {x}}^{T}(s)\mathbf {R}\dot{\mathbf {x}}(s)\); especially, a new tighter integral inequality was proposed in [6], which yields less conservative stability conditions.
Besides, the Takagi-Sugeno (T-S) fuzzy model [8] is normally used to describe fuzzy control systems. It can represent the dynamics of a complex nonlinear system as a weighted sum of some local linear models, which will facilitate the stability analysis. When the fuzzy controller is also denoted as a weighted sum of some linear sub-controllers, and is connected with the T-S fuzzy model in a closed loop, a Takagi-Sugeno fuzzy-model-based (TSFMB) control system is formed. When dealing with the stabilization analysis problem for TSFMB system, an efficient technique named parallel distribution compensation (PDC) [9] is usually adopted, which requires the fuzzy controller and the T-S fuzzy model have the same premise membership functions and the same number of rules. Such design can make the stabilization analysis easier. However, PDC method also bears some inevitable drawbacks such as limiting the design flexibility of the fuzzy controller and complicating the fuzzy controller structure unnecessarily in some cases. For the sake of solving these problems, some non-PDC design techniques were developed [7, 8]. Among them, an effective methodology called imperfect premise matching method [8], which allows the fuzzy controller and the fuzzy model use different premise membership functions and different number of rules. Hence, this approach can avoid the limitations of PDC method.
Currently, the research of stability and stabilization analysis for TSFMB systems with time-delay has yet been thorough enough. First, most of literature applied PDC method to conduct stabilization analysis which would limit the design flexibility of fuzzy controller. Second, the existing stability and stabilization conditions can be further relaxed. This is because the bound of integral term \(\int _{t-h}^{t}\dot{\mathbf {x}}^{T}(s)\mathbf {R}\dot{\mathbf {x}}(s)\) can be estimated more accurate, and the information of the membership functions has not been applied fully. Therefore, in this paper, we aim to investigate the improved stability and stabilization conditions for TSFMB systems with time-delay.
To achieve our goal, we will apply the imperfect premise matching method to design stable fuzzy controller. In order to relax the results, we will employ the novel integral inequality technique in the stability analysis, and take the information of the membership functions into account. The analyses results will be presented as theorems in terms of LMIs. Finally, a numerical example will be given to illustrate the advantages and superiority of the proposed approach.
2 Preliminaries
A TSFMB nonlinear control system with distributed time delay is considered.
Fuzzy Model: Construct a p-rule polynomial fuzzy model to represent the nonlinear system with time-delay:
where \(\mathbf {x}(t) \in \mathbb {R}^{n\times 1}\) denotes the vector of the system state; \(\mathbf {A}_{i}\in \mathbb {R}^{n\times n},\mathbf {A}_{1i}\in \mathbb {R}^{n\times n},\mathbf {A}_{2i}\in \mathbb {R}^{n\times n}\) and \(\mathbf {B}_{i}\in \mathbb {R}^{n\times m}\) represent the system matrices and the system input matrices; \(\mathbf {u}(t) \in \mathbb {R}^{m\times 1}\) is system input; the time-delay h is a constant satisfying \(h\in [h_{min}, h_{max}]\); \(\omega _{i}(\mathbf {x}(t))\) stands for the normalized grade of membership, and satisfying: \(\omega _{i}(\mathbf {x}(t))\ge 0\) for all i, and \(\sum _{i=1}^{p}\omega _{i}(\mathbf {x}(t))=1\).
Fuzzy Controller: Motivated by the imperfect premise matching method [8], we consider a c-rule polynomial fuzzy controller in this paper:
where \(\mathbf {K}_{j}\in \mathbb {R}^{m\times n}\) represents the feedback gain of jth rule; \(m_{j}(\mathbf {x}(t))\) stands for the normalized grade of membership, and satisfying: \(m_{j}(\mathbf {x}(t))\ge 0\) for all i, and \(\sum _{j=1}^{c}m_{j}(\mathbf {x}(t))=1\).
According to (1) and (2), the closed-loop fuzzy control system can be easily acquired:
where \(\mathbf {G}_{ij}=\mathbf {A}_{i}+\mathbf {B}_{i}\mathbf {K}_{j},\quad i=1,2,...,p,\quad j=1,2,...,c.\)
Lemma 1 is given to facilitate the proof of the main results in the following sections.
Lemma 1
[6]. It is assumed that \(\mathbf {x}(t)\) is a differentiable function: \([\alpha ,\beta ]\rightarrow \mathbb {R}^{n}\). For \(\mathbf {N}_{1}, \mathbf {N}_{2}, \mathbf {N}_{3} \in \mathbb {R}^{4n\times n}\), and \(\mathbf {R} \in \mathbb {R}^{n\times n }> 0\), the following inequality holds:
where
In addition, to simplify the computational complexity, \(\omega _{i}(\mathbf {x}(t))\) and \(m_{j}(\mathbf {x}(t))\) will be denoted has \(\omega _{i}\) and \(m_{j}\), respectively in the following sections.
3 Stability Analysis
Firstly, the stability condition of TSFMB autonomous system, i.e., the system (1) with \(\mathbf {u}(t)=\mathbf {0}\), will be investigated, which can be described by
The inferred stability analysis results are summarized in the following theorems.
Theorem 1
For TSFMB autonomous system (1) and a prescribed constant \(h\in [h_{min}, h_{max}]\), if there exist positive definite matrices \(\mathbf {P}=\mathbf {P}^{T}\in \mathbb {R}^{3n\times 3n}, \mathbf {R}=\mathbf {R}^{T}\in \mathbb {R}^{n\times n}\), \(\mathbf {Q}=\mathbf {Q}^{T}\in \mathbb {R}^{n\times n}\), such that LMIs (6) are satisfied, then the system (1) is asymptotically stable.
where
and \(\varDelta _{1},\varDelta _{2},\varDelta _{3}\) are defined in Lemma 1. Besides, in order to decrease the computational complexity, we will eliminate the free matrices \(\mathbf {N}_{1}, \mathbf {N}_{2}, \mathbf {N}_{3}\) by assuming \(\mathbf {N}_{1}=\frac{1}{h}\left[ \begin{matrix} -\mathbf {R}&\mathbf {R}&\mathbf {0}&\mathbf {0} \end{matrix}\right] ^{T},\) \(\mathbf {N}_{2}=\frac{3}{h}\left[ \begin{matrix} -\mathbf {R}&-\mathbf {R}&2\mathbf {R}&\mathbf {0} \end{matrix}\right] ^{T},\) \(\mathbf {N}_{3}=\frac{5}{h}\left[ \begin{matrix} -\mathbf {R}&\mathbf {R}&6\mathbf {R}&-6\mathbf {R} \end{matrix}\right] ^{T}.\)
Proof
To investigate the stability of the TSFMB autonomous system (1), the following Lyapunov-Krasovskii functional candidate is considered.
where \(\mathbf {\eta }_{1}(t)=\int _{t-h}^{t}\mathbf {x}(s)ds,\) \(\mathbf {\eta }_{2}(t)=\int _{t-h}^{t}\int _{t-h}^{s}\mathbf {x}(u)duds.\)
Therefore, the derivative of V(t) can be presented as
where \(\mathbf {\zeta }(t)=\left[ \mathbf {x}^{T}(t) \quad \mathbf {x}^{T}(t-h) \quad \frac{1}{h}\mathbf {\eta }_{1}^{T}(t) \quad \frac{2}{h^{2}}\mathbf {\eta }_{2}^{T}(t) \right] ^{T}\), and \(\mathbf {\Phi }_{1i}\) is defined in (6).
Moreover, according to Lemma 1, we can obtain
where \(\varPhi _2,\varPhi _3\) are defined in (4). So we have
After some algebraic manipulations, we get
where \(\underline{\omega }_{i}\) is the lower bound of \(\omega _{i}\), and \(\bar{\omega }_{i}\) is the upper bound of \(\omega _{i}\), \(\mathbf {F}_{i}\) and \(\mathbf {T}_{i}\) are positive semi-definite matrics. Hence, if
then \(\dot{V}(t)<\mathbf {0}\). By using Schur Complement theorem, the condition (12) is equivalent to condition (6). In other words, if condition (6) holds, the system (1) is asymptotically stable. Thus, the proof of Theorem 1 is accomplished.
Remark 1
It can be seen from the proof that a novel integral inequality (9) is adopted to deal with integral term \(-\int _{t-h}^{t}\dot{\mathbf {x}}^{T}(s)\mathbf {R}\dot{\mathbf {x}}(s)ds\). The advantage of this integral inequality is that it is tighter than other similar integral inequalities, which can relax the results. Additionally, since the stability condition derived from it has a simpler structure, the implementation costs could be lowered.
4 Stabilization Analysis
Based on Theorem 1, we will mainly investigate how to design a fuzzy controller (2) to stabilize TSFMB control system (3) in this section.
Theorem 2
For TSFMB control system (3) and the given constants \(\sigma \), \(t_{i}, i=2,3,..,6\), \(h\in [h_{min}, h_{max}]\), if there exist positive definite matrices \(\bar{\mathbf {P}}=\bar{\mathbf {P}}^{T}\in \mathbb {R}^{3n\times 3n}, \bar{\mathbf {R}}=\bar{\mathbf {R}}^{T}\in \mathbb {R}^{n\times n},\) \(\bar{\mathbf {Q}}=\bar{\mathbf {Q}}^{T}\in \mathbb {R}^{n\times n}\), and positive semi-definite matrices \(\bar{\mathbf {F}}_{i}=\bar{\mathbf {F}}_{i}^{T}\in \mathbb {R}^{4n\times 4n}, \bar{\mathbf {T}}_{i}=\bar{\mathbf {T}}_{i}^{T}\in \mathbb {R}^{4n\times 4n}\), such that LMIs (13) are satisfied, then the system (3) is asymptotically stable.
where
And the state feedback gain can be denoted as \(\mathbf {K}_{j}=\bar{\mathbf {K}}_{j}\mathbf {X}^{-1}\). \( i=1,2,...,p,\quad j=1,2,...,c.\)
Proof
Substitute \(\mathbf {A}_{i}\) for \(\mathbf {G}_{ij}=\mathbf {A}_i+\mathbf {B}_{i}\mathbf {K}_{j}\), and by following the same line of analysis of Theorem 1, we can obtain
Applying Lemma 1, we have
Since
where
So we have \(\zeta ^{T}(t)(\mathbf {\Phi }_{1ij}+\mathbf {\Phi }_{2}+\mathbf {\Phi }_{3})\zeta (t)=\zeta ^{T}(t)(\mathbf {M}_{1ij}+\mathbf {M}_{2}+\mathbf {M}_{3ij}+\mathbf {M}_{4} +\mathbf {M}_{5}+\mathbf {M}_{6})\zeta (t).\) Therefore, if
we can obtain \(\dot{V}(t)<0\).
Define some new variables as
Let Eq. (17) be pre-multiplied and post-multiplied by and its transpose, then we can obtain
So we have
where \(\bar{\mathbf {\Phi }}_{1ij}\), \(\bar{\mathbf {\Phi }}_{2}\), \(\bar{\mathbf {\Phi }}_{3}\), \(i=1,2,...,p\), \(j=1,2,...,c\) are defined in (13).
By denoting \(\omega _{i}m_{j}\) as \(h_{ij}\), \(i=1,2,...,p, j=1,2,...c,\) and using similar algebraic manipulations as in the proof of Theorem 1, we can get
where \(\bar{h}_{ij}\ge h_{ij}\) is the upper bound of \(h_{ij}\), \(\underline{h}_{ij}\le h_{ij}\) is the lower bound of \(h_{ij}\), \(\bar{\mathbf {F}}_{ij}=\bar{\mathbf {F}}^{T}_{ij}\ge \mathbf {0}\), and \(\bar{\mathbf {T}}_{ij}=\bar{\mathbf {T}}^{T}_{ij}\ge \mathbf {0}\).
So if
we can obtain \(\dot{V}(t)<0\), which means the closed-loop TSFMB control system (3) is asymptotically stable.
Applying Schur Complement theorem, inequality (22) can be denoted as
where \(\varPi _{1}=\bar{\mathbf {\Phi }}_{1ij}+\bar{\mathbf {\Phi }}_{3}+\bar{\mathbf {\Phi }}_{4ij}, i=1,2,...,p, j=1,2,...,c.\)
Moreover, as \(\mathbf {R}\) is symmetric and positive definite matrix, for any scalar \(\sigma \), the following inequality holds:
Then we have
which means inequalities (23) is true, if LMIs (13) holds. Thus, the proof of Theorem 2 is completed.
5 Numerical Examples
In this section, a numerical example is given to demonstrate the effectiveness of the proposed methods.
Example 1
Consider a TSFMB autonomous system in the form of (1) with
Using the stability conditions introduced in literature [1,2,3, 9, 10] and Theorem 1 of this paper, respectively to calculate the maximum allowable time-delays. The results are presented in the following table.
From Table 1, we can see that Theorem 1 of this paper can yield larger maximum allowable time-delays h than literature [1,2,3, 9, 10], which means the proposed method in this paper is less conservative than the ones in [1,2,3, 9, 10].
Remark 2
There are two reasons for the less conservative results in Example 1. First, the introduction of the new integral inequality (4), which is tighter than other existing integral inequalities. Second, Theorem 1 of this paper takes the information of membership functions into consideration while the methods in other literature are membership functions independent.
6 Conclusion
This paper concerns the stability and stabilization analysis issue of TSFMB control systems with distributed time-delay. The imperfect premise matching methodology has been employed to design fuzzy controller, which allows the fuzzy controller to use different premise membership functions and different number of rules from the fuzzy model. Hence, greater design flexibility can be achieved. Besides, a tighter integral inequality has been applied, and the information of the membership functions has been introduced in the criteria as well. As a consequence, less conservative stability conditions and stabilization criteria have been developed. Finally, a numerical example has been provided to illustrate the effectiveness of the proposed approach.
References
Zhao, Y., Gao, H., Lam, J., Du, B.: Stability and stabilization of delayed T-S fuzzy systems: a delay partitioning approach. IEEE Trans. Fuzzy Syst. 17(4), 750–762 (2009)
Mozelli, L.A., Souza, F.O., Palhares, R.M.: A new discretized Lyapunov-Krasovskii functional for stability analysis and control design of time-delayed T-S fuzzy systems. Int. J. Robust Nonlinear Control 21(1), 93–105 (2011)
Wu, H.N., Li, H.X.: New approach to delay-dependent stability analysis and stabilization for continuous-time fuzzy systems with time-varying delay. IEEE Trans. Fuzzy Syst. 15(3), 482–493 (2007)
Wu, M., He, Y., She, J.H., Liu, G.P.: Delay-dependent criteria for robust stability of time-varying delay systems. Automatica 40(8), 1435–1439 (2004)
Seuret, A., Gouaisbaut, F.: Wirtinger-based integral inequality: application to time-delay systems. Automatica 60, 189–192 (2015)
Hong, B.Z., Yong, H., Min, W., Jinhua, S.: New results on stability analysis for systems with discrete distributed delay. Automatica 60, 189–192 (2015)
Pan, J.T., Guerra, T.M., Fei, S.M., Jaadari, A.: Nonquadratic stabilization of continuous T-S fuzzy models: LMI solution for a local approach. IEEE Trans. Fuzzy Syst. 20(3), 594–602 (2013)
Lam, H.K., Narimani, M.: Stability analysis and performance design for fuzzy-model-based control system under imperfect premise matching. IEEE Trans. Fuzzy Syst. 17(4), 949–961 (2009)
Zhao, L., Gao, H., Karimi, H.R.: Robust stability and stabilization of uncertain T-S fuzzy systems with time-varying delay: an input-output approach. IEEE Trans. Fuzzy Syst. 21(5), 883–897 (2013)
Zhang, Z., Lin, C., Chen, B.: New stability and stabilization conditions for T-S fuzzy systems with time delay. Fuzzy Sets Syst. 263, 82–91 (2015)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2017 Springer International Publishing AG
About this paper
Cite this paper
Ma, Q., Xia, H., Ma, G., Xia, Y., Wang, C. (2017). Improved Stability and Stabilization Criteria for T-S Fuzzy Systems with Distributed Time-Delay. In: Tan, Y., Takagi, H., Shi, Y. (eds) Data Mining and Big Data. DMBD 2017. Lecture Notes in Computer Science(), vol 10387. Springer, Cham. https://doi.org/10.1007/978-3-319-61845-6_51
Download citation
DOI: https://doi.org/10.1007/978-3-319-61845-6_51
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-61844-9
Online ISBN: 978-3-319-61845-6
eBook Packages: Computer ScienceComputer Science (R0)